Does this config snippet look OK?
Getting the following error on startup using both the tip code versions,
and the versions in the 4.99.18 tarballs:
[03/May/2019:20:52:12][25299.7fcd9d1de700][-main-] Notice: modload: loading
module ns/db/driver/mysql from file nsdbmysql
[03/May/2019:20:52:12][25299.7fcd9d1de700][-main-] Error: modload:
/usr/local/ns/bin/nsdbmysql.so: couldn't load file
"/usr/local/ns/bin/nsdbmysql.so": /usr/local/ns/bin/nsdbmysql.so: undefined
symbol: Ns_DbDriverName
[03/May/2019:20:52:12][25299.7fcd9d1de700][-main-] Error: dbdrv: failed to
load driver 'mysql'
<---->
ns_section "ns/server/default/modules" {
ns_param nscp nscp
ns_param nssock nssock
ns_param nslog nslog
ns_param nscgi nscgi
ns_param nsdb nsdb
}
ns_section "ns/db/drivers" {
ns_param mysql nsdbmysql.so ;# Load MySQL driver
}
ns_section "ns/db/pools" {
ns_param dbpool "MySQL Pool"
}
ns_section "ns/db/pool/dbpool" {
ns_param driver mysql
ns_param connections 5
ns_param user dbuser
ns_param password xxxx
ns_param datasource hostname:3306:databasename
ns_param verbose on
}
